Caged Minds
This isn't Hotel California.

Despite the five star rating, there is nothing sunny and warm about this luxurious downtown Chicago hotel. Five important guests are arriving - invited, coerced, and even blackmailed by an unknown benefactor known only to each of them as their HOST.

These five Alpha personalities are forced to remain together in penthouse Suite 1601, the top floor of the hotel – operating under the strict guidelines and instructions secreted to them by their HOST. Of these five, three are renowned journalists, household names easily recognized by years of primetime news and television exposé's.

Each participant believes they are present to use their unique career gifts to interview, report, or rout out some mystery worthy of a career enhancing Pulitzer Prize.

It is not until their Cooperative is forced to report on a death inside the hotel, until all exits are sealed, that a dire threat will erase all of their preconceived ideas.

Nothing is as it seems. Each member inside the cage will extract a variety of beliefs from the same clues, while trying to escape the maze of fears inside the hotel.

About the Author

David Pyle lives in Texas and is the author of several thrillers and tales of the supernatural. His personal website - Pentwist.com – contains a library of free help and information for new writers.
